High school sports roundup: North Catholic has big day at county cross country meet

View and purchase Eagle photos at photos.butlereagle.com

North Catholic’s Madeline Meeuf (20:34.79), Tessa Driehorst (20:53.48), Anna Morris (20:59.90) and Caroline Sell (21:03.79) took the top four places of the girls’ side at Saturday’s Butler County 5K Fall Classic cross country meet at Seneca Valley.

With a time of 21:11.96, Slippery Rock’s Leah Perez took fifth. The Trojanettes’ Sydney Dunn (21:22.95) and Ava Sparacino (21:32.14) rounded out the top 7. Elise Cilik (8th, 21:45.86) had Seneca Valley’s best time; while Freeport’s Elizabeth Wesolosky (21st, 23:08.68), Moniteau’s Alexis Kirschner (23rd, 23:34.39) and Karns City’s Megan Hartle (27th, 23:55.54) led their teams.

— On the boys’ side, North Catholic’s Tyler Carroll (16:29.62) and Jack Steineman (16:45.03) finished 1-2. Freeport’s David Kristine (3rd, 17:07.02), Seneca Valley’s Riley McGee (4th, 17:14.93), Karns City’s Noah Weiland (5th, 18:20.65) and Slippery Rock’s Hunter Doerflinger (6th, 18:28.71).

— Butler junior Brendan Eicher finished 11th in the 5,000-meter finals at the HOKA Showcase Invitational at Ohio’s Riverside High School on Saturday night.

Junior Brendan Eicher (11th, 16:03.20) and seniors Ethan Thomas (15th, 16:10.66) and Logan Rogers (43rd, 16:49.31) medaled for the Golden Tornado, whose boys finished sixth at the meet. Zari Golojuh (65th, 20:27.53) was the best finisher for Butler’s girls, who placed 20th.

Boys soccer

Spencer Valasek notched a hat trick and Conor Rumbaugh and Carson Rowley also scored goals as Freeport downed Jeanette 5-0 on Saturday.

Henry Good had a pair of saves for the Yellowjackets (1-0) in the shutout. Freeport visits Shady Side Academy on Tuesday.

Fairview 4, Mars 1 — The Planets (1-1) suffered their first loss of the young season. They welcome in Hampton on Tuesday.

Girls soccer

Liv Halliday netted a pair of Mars and Miley Gratton added another to give the Planets a 3-0 win over Kiski on Saturday. Mars (2-0) will host Yough on Monday.

DuBois 5, Karns City 2 — Aubrey Price’s two goals weren’t enough for the Gremlins (1-1), who play Punxsutawney at home on Tuesday.

Girls tennis

Evelyn Marche, Macaria Stall and Anna Ravotti had singles wins as North Catholic downed Mars 4-1 on Friday. Claire Elliott and Kaitlyn Abel had a doubles victory for the Trojanettes, while Elaina Riegler and Grace Nam paired up to win one for the Planets.
